Approaches
The Port of Norreborg can only be called during the day. The harbor can be difficult to call at if it is blowing strongly from the northwest. The entrance to the port is not marked. The depth of the harbor basin is 2.5 meters.

Details

Norreborg Harbor is located on the north coast of the Swedish island of Venn. The harbor is not that big, and it is also Ven's smallest harbor. In high season it can be difficult to find a place.

There are the most basic facilities in the harbor, but if you want a larger selection of shopping opportunities, you must go to Tuna, which is the island's capital.

Attractions

There is a fine sandy beach right by the harbor.

Tycho Brahe's castle and observatory, which is called Uranienborg, is located on Venn. Uranienborg was built around the year 1580. The castle has a geometric garden designed by Tycho Brahe. The inner garden had flowers and many herbs for use in medical research and in the household. The outer garden was possessed by fruit trees. Attempts have been made to reconstruct the castle garden according to Tycho Brahe's drawings and descriptions.

It is recommended to cycle around Venn.
